Description:

1,2,5,6-Tetrabromocyclooctane is a model species in cell biology. It is used to study the effects of reactive oxygen species on mitochondrial function. 1,2,5,6-Tetrabromocyclooctane is covalently bonded with cysteine residues in the mitochondrial membrane and prevents the oxidation of lipids in this area. The accumulation of reactive oxygen species causes mitochondrial dysfunction and apoptosis by activating caspase-9 and increasing insulin-like growth factor 1 (IGF-1) expression. This compound has been shown to have a number of different isomers that have different effects on cells.
